The following section details the approach to deriving the correct efficiency for solid fuel appliances based on fuel type and efficiency data available for the appliance.
1) If the appliance fuel type as per guidance here matches the test data fuel type then the gross efficiency is used if it is shown on the test certificate or on HARP.

2) If the appliance fuel type as per guidance here matches the test certificate fuel type but the test certificate only shows the net efficiency then the net/gross conversion described in Appendix E must be applied (see Table 4.32).

3) If the appliance fuel type is solid multifuel then the Assessor should consider the average efficiency from available solid fuel test data. This may be a single efficiency for a single fuel type or multiple efficiencies for multiple fuel types. The data could be from HARP or from other accredited sources. If the test data specifies gross efficiencies, such as on HARP, then the average of these can be used in DEAP. If the test data efficiencies are net, then these are averaged and the solid fuel net/gross conversion of 0.94 set out in table 4.32 must be applied.

This appendix sets out the method to be used to determine the gross seasonal efficiency for gas, oil, or solid fuel room heaters. BER assessors are encouraged to source efficiency data for these room heaters from the HARP database. Declared seasonal efficiencies acceptable for UK SAP calculations are also acceptable for DEAP calculations provided suitable substantiating evidence (such as a test certificate) is supplied.
The EPREL database may be used as a source of efficiency for solid fuel room heaters.
Test results obtained by one of the recognised methods given in Table 4.29, Table 4.30 and Table 4.31 may be used to establish a seasonal efficiency for DEAP calculations.
| Test Standard | Description |
|---|---|
| IS EN 613:2000 | Independent gas-fired convection heaters |
| I.S. EN 613:2021 | Independent closed-fronted gas-fired type B11, type C11, type C31 and type C91 heaters |
| IS EN 13278:2013 | Open-fronted gas-fired independent space heaters |
| IS EN 1266:2002 | Independent gas-fired convection heaters incorporating a fan to assist transportation of combustion air and/or flue gases |
| BS 7977-1:2009 | Specification for safety and rational use of energy of gas domestic appliances. Part 1: Radiant/convectors |
| BS 7977-2:2003 | Specification for safety and rational use of energy of gas domestic appliances. Part 2: Combined appliances: Gas fire/back boiler |
| Test Standard | Description |
|---|---|
| OFS A102:2004 | Oil fired room heaters with atomising or vaporising burners with or without boilers, heat output up to 25 kW |
| Test Standard | Description |
|---|---|
| I.S. EN 16510-1 | Residential solid fuel burning appliances - Part 1: General requirements and test methods |
| I.S. EN 16510-2-1 | Residential solid fuel burning appliances - Part 2-1: Roomheaters |
| EN 13229 | Inset appliances including open fires fired by solid fuels - Requirements and test methods |
| EN 13240 | Roomheaters fired by solid fuel - Requirements and test methods |
| I.S. EN 14785:2006 | Residential space heating appliances fired by wood pellets - Requirements and test methods |
| EN 16510-2-6 | Residential solid fuel burning appliances - Part 2-6: Mechanically by wood pellets fed roomheaters, inset appliances and cookers |
Efficiency test results are normally calculated using the net calorific value of fuel. Before a declaration can be made, conversion to gross must be carried out by multiplying the efficiency by the appropriate conversion factor given in Table 4.32 below if test results are not based on the gross calorific values of the relevant fuel.
| Fuel | Net-to-gross conversion factor Description |
|---|---|
| Natural gas | 0.901 |
| LPG (propane or butane) | 0.921 |
| Oil (kerosene or gas oil) | 0.937 |
| Biodiesel or bioethanol | 0.937 |
| Coal | 0.97 |
| Anthracite or manufactured smokeless fuels | 0.98 |
| Wood fuels | 0.91 |
| Solid multi-fuel | 0.94 |
Manufacturers’ declarations so calculated should be accompanied by the following wording and should be accompanied by the associated test certificates from an accredited laboratory.
“The gross seasonal efficiency of this appliance has been measured as specified in [insert appropriate entry from Table 4.29 or Table 4.30 or Table 4.31] and the result is [x]%. The gross calorific value of the fuel has been used for this efficiency calculation. The test data was certified by [insert name and/or identification of notified body]. The efficiency value may be used in the Irish Government’s Dwelling Energy Assessment Procedure (DEAP) for energy rating of dwellings.”
Where net efficiencies are identified from test data, they must be converted to gross efficiencies before use in DEAP assessments.
The efficiency of solid fuel room heaters may be sourced from the EPREL database. The useful energy efficiency (at nominal heat output) must be converted to the gross calorific value for entry in DEAP. The datasheet from EPREL should be downloaded from the database and uploaded to DEAP in the evidence file.
The preferred source of efficiency data is HARP and certified data may also be used. However, efficiencies for solid fuel heaters without boilers can be sourced from the HETAS listing. Use the gross efficiency if listed, or else use table 4.32 to convert to a gross efficiency from net efficiency. Apply rules from the efficiency data for solid fuel appliances section to identify the correct efficiency dependent on fuel type. Do not use HETAS to source efficiencies for DEAP for boilers or appliances with back boilers.
